The term "Ethereum Killer" (the time when another platform Overtakes Ethereum) has been around as long as "The Flippening" (the time when another cryptocurrency overtakes Bitcoin in market cap).

But while "The Flippening" is easy to understand, the term "The Ethereum Killer" is harder to define.

Some think it means the same as total market cap (a kind of "Flippening of Ethereum).

Some believe that is when a platform has more tokens and transactions than Ethereum.

Others believe it means that TX fees on another platform are drastically less as compared to Ethereum - while residing on both; as in the case of Tether (both an ERC20 and TRC20 token) which runs on Ethereum and Tron.

IMHO, the true "Ethereum Killer" will not possess just one of the above, but ALL of them.
